Last week, a judge in Manhattan announced that he was delaying the sentencing of Donald J. Trump until after the election. It is the only one of the four criminal cases against the former president that will have gone to trial before voters go to the polls.

Ben Protess, an investigative reporter for The New York Times, discusses Mr. Trump’s remarkable legal win and its limits.

Guest: Ben Protess, an investigative reporter for The New York Times.

Background reading:

• Judge Juan M. Merchan delayed Trump’s sentencing until Nov. 26 • , after Election Day. • Mr. Trump owes the delay in part to his legal resources and political status.
